Meaning of "wolfsangel"

Wolfsangel refers to a heraldic symbol or emblem in the shape of a wolf-hook
Show more definitions
  • A wolf hook.
  • A Z/N/ᴎ/ϟ-shaped symbol, reminiscent of the Germanic wolf hook hunting device
